Title: Re: 10$ to help get joker working in P:M
Post by: windhunter7 on June 04, 2016, 05:17:23 AM
It's because of filesize; regular Snake's .pcs files are all less than 600 KB, and I would recommend going no more than 577; possibly less. You can lower filesize by exporting the textures, lowering the texture resolution in MS Paint, and replacing the textures with those lower-res textures; preview the model, though, just to make sure that it doesn't look crappy. Title: Re: 10$ to help get joker working in P:M
Post by: windhunter7 on June 05, 2016, 02:31:48 PM
To resize the image and keep the textures mapped properly, just do what I said and export the textures and re-import them back into BrawlBox after using MS Paint's Stretch/Skew button to half the dimensions. The texture editing should in no way edit the mapping of the textures.

As for making the filesize smaller without affecting the dimensions, you can export the textures, and then re-import them as CMPR(It reduces filesize like crazy, and keeps basically all the detail), but in this case, all the textures were already CMPR.
